My Daffodil

Oh daffodil of my life
Alone in my orchard with delight
Untainted like offspring of heaven
If ever that be. Like shining Helen
Grafted throu' Cupid's bow to Paris' soul
You sleep in my heart never waking to 
cock crow.

The Sun

Prying voyeur
Shining eye of heaven,
Why but this assunder?
Why call on our amorous souls
From the romance of silent night
By your glint throu' chunks and curtains?

Peeping Tom
Herald of waking dawn
Like a sexton calling sleepers 
For morning prayer;
Why flash throu' the irises
Of our courting eyes?

Oh morning!
I weep to see you come so soon
In the company of this voyeuristic sun.
